India’s industrial sector is increasingly looking for reliable, cost-efficient and centralized utility solutions, particularly for energy-intensive manufacturing clusters. Operating in this niche is Steamhouse India Limited, a Gujarat-based company that generates and distributes industrial steam through community boiler systems and pipeline networks. The company has also expanded into nitrogen distribution, adding another industrial gas to its portfolio.

The Steamhouse IPO is scheduled to open for subscription on September 9, 2026, and close on September 11, 2026. The book-built issue is expected to raise up to ₹414 crore through a combination of fresh shares and an Offer for Sale (OFS). The equity shares are proposed to be listed on both the BSE and NSE.

For investors evaluating the issue, the key questions go beyond the IPO size. Steamhouse has demonstrated revenue and profit growth, but it also operates a capital-intensive business with meaningful borrowings. Its planned debt repayment and capacity expansion therefore become important factors in assessing the company’s post-IPO growth prospects.

Steamhouse IPO: Key Issue Details

Steamhouse India is coming to the primary market through a book-built issue comprising a fresh issue and an Offer for Sale. According to the latest available IPO information, the total issue size is ₹414 crore. The face value of each equity share is ₹2.

What Does Steamhouse India Do?

Steamhouse India Limited was incorporated in 2015 and is headquartered in Surat, Gujarat. The company specializes in the generation and centralized distribution of industrial steam and nitrogen through pipeline networks.

Its key business concept is the community boiler system. Instead of every industrial customer installing and operating its own steam-generation infrastructure, Steamhouse generates steam through centralized boiler facilities and distributes it to nearby customers through dedicated pipeline networks.

The company operates seven community steam boilers in Gujarat, comprising six owned facilities and one leased facility. As of July 31, 2026, the combined installed steam-generation capacity stood at 345 tonnes per hour, supported by an operational pipeline network of approximately 60,151 metres.

Steamhouse serves customers across several industrial sectors, including pharmaceuticals, chemicals, agrochemicals, textiles, tyres, dyes and pigments, polymers and paints. Its customer base increased to 202 customers in FY2026 from 125 in FY2024. Repeat customers contributed approximately 90.72% of FY2026 operating revenue, indicating a significant contribution from existing customers.

Steamhouse Business Model and Operations

1. Centralized Steam Generation

Steam generation and distribution is the company’s core activity. Steamhouse operates community boilers located close to industrial clusters, allowing it to distribute steam directly to nearby manufacturing facilities.

This model can reduce the need for customers to maintain their own steam-generation infrastructure while giving Steamhouse the opportunity to serve multiple industrial units through shared facilities.

2. Purchased Steam Distribution

Apart from generating steam itself, Steamhouse also purchases steam from other generators and distributes it through its pipeline network. This gives the company an additional source of supply and helps broaden its distribution operations.

3. Nitrogen Distribution

Steamhouse entered nitrogen production and distribution in February 2025. Its nitrogen business uses a pipeline-based distribution model instead of relying solely on conventional cryogenic tank transportation or individual onsite generation.

This gives the company an opportunity to expand its industrial gas portfolio beyond steam.

4. Coal Trading

Coal trading also contributes to the company’s revenue mix. In FY2026, coal trading accounted for approximately 26.92% of revenue, while steam generation and distribution contributed 52.14% and purchased steam distribution contributed 17.70%.

The revenue mix is important because it shows that Steamhouse is not solely dependent on its own steam-generation operations.

Steamhouse IPO: Objects of the Issue

The fresh issue proceeds are intended to strengthen the company’s balance sheet and support expansion of its infrastructure.

According to the available IPO information, Steamhouse plans to allocate a substantial portion of the fresh proceeds towards debt repayment, while the remaining funds will support capacity expansion at existing facilities and the development of a new steam-generation facility.

The ₹180 crore debt repayment is particularly significant because it could reduce the company’s financial leverage and interest burden. At the same time, the proposed expansion projects are intended to increase the company’s operating capacity.

Steamhouse India Financial Performance

Steamhouse has reported substantial growth in revenue over the last three financial years. Revenue from operations increased from ₹291.71 crore in FY2024 to ₹395.11 crore in FY2025 and further to ₹491.51 crore in FY2026. PAT increased from ₹27.19 crore to ₹31.16 crore and then to ₹38.64 crore during the same period.

The numbers show strong revenue growth, but profitability has not expanded at the same pace as the top line. The PAT margin declined from 9.32% in FY2024 to 7.86% in FY2026. At the same time, the debt-to-equity ratio improved from 1.77x to 1.57x.

Steamhouse IPO: Key Strengths

Strong Revenue Growth

Revenue from operations increased from ₹291.71 crore in FY2024 to ₹491.51 crore in FY2026, representing a strong expansion in the company’s operating scale.

Established Industrial Customer Base

Steamhouse serves customers across pharmaceuticals, chemicals, textiles, agrochemicals, tyres, polymers and other industries. Its customer count increased from 125 in FY2024 to 202 in FY2026.

Community Boiler Infrastructure

The centralized community boiler model gives Steamhouse an established infrastructure base in industrial clusters. Its seven boilers had a combined installed capacity of 345 TPH as of July 31, 2026.

Expansion into Nitrogen

The company’s entry into pipeline-based nitrogen distribution provides another potential growth avenue and reduces its dependence on a single industrial gas category.

Debt Reduction Through IPO

The proposed ₹180 crore allocation towards repayment or prepayment of borrowings could strengthen the balance sheet and reduce financial pressure after the IPO.

Steamhouse IPO: Key Risks

High Debt Levels

Although the debt-to-equity ratio improved to 1.57x in FY2026, the company remains leveraged. The proposed debt repayment is therefore important for improving financial flexibility.

Margin Pressure

PAT margin declined from 9.32% in FY2024 to 7.86% in FY2026, while EBITDA margin also declined from 23.45% to 16.99%. Investors should monitor whether future expansion translates into improved profitability.

Capital-Intensive Business

Steam boilers, pipelines and industrial utility infrastructure require significant capital investment. Delays in commissioning new capacity or lower customer utilization could affect returns.

Industrial Customer Concentration

The company’s operations are closely linked to industrial clusters and manufacturing activity. A slowdown in customer production or loss of important customers could affect steam demand and revenue.

Exposure to Commodity Prices

The company uses coal and other fuels in its operations and also has a coal trading business. Changes in fuel prices and commodity-market conditions can therefore influence its financial performance.

Steamhouse India: Promoters and Ownership

Steamhouse India Limited is promoted by Vishal Sanwarprasad Budhia, Ritu Budhia, VSB Business Trust, Budhia Business Trust and VB Business Trust. The promoter group held approximately 98.69% of the company before the IPO, while other shareholders held the remaining 1.31%.

The IPO also includes an Offer for Sale of up to ₹61 crore, under which existing shareholders will sell part of their holdings. The fresh issue, meanwhile, provides capital directly to the company for debt reduction and expansion.

Steamhouse IPO Review: What Should Investors Watch?

Steamhouse presents an unusual industrial business model built around centralized steam generation and pipeline distribution. Its community boiler infrastructure provides a differentiated proposition for industrial customers that require continuous steam but may not want to operate independent boiler systems.

The company has also demonstrated strong revenue growth, with revenue from operations increasing from ₹291.71 crore in FY2024 to ₹491.51 crore in FY2026. PAT increased from ₹27.19 crore to ₹38.64 crore during the same period.

However, investors should not overlook the other side of the financial picture. EBITDA and PAT margins have declined, while the company continues to carry significant debt. The ₹180 crore debt repayment planned from IPO proceeds can address part of this concern, but the company’s ability to generate adequate returns from its expansion projects will remain important.

The final Steamhouse IPO price band will be one of the most important factors in determining whether the issue is reasonably valued. Until that information is available, investors should avoid drawing conclusions based solely on revenue growth, EPS or GMP.
